HomeMy WebLinkAbout2022.08.15 RESO 2022 - 53 Costs to be Assessed for 121st/Acres of Bald EagleRESOLUTION NO.2022 — 53 A RESOLUTION DECLARING THE COST TO BE ASSESSED AND ORDERING PREPARATION OF PROPOSED ASSESSMENT ROLL FOR THE 121st STREET AND ACRES OF BALD EAGLE UTILITY AND STREET IMPROVEMENTS CITY OF HUGO, WASHINGTON COUNTY, MN WHEREAS estimated costs have been calculated for the 121 st Street and Acres of Bald Eagle Utility and Street Improvements consisting of sanitary sewer services and watermain services to benefitting properties along 121 st Street North from Everton Avenue North to Falcon Avenue North. Costs associated with the Acres of Bald Eagle are the responsibility of the developer and identified by separate agreement. The estimated cost for such improvements is $113,315.64. That portion of the project that is assessable is the sanitary sewer and watermain service improvements with estimated costs is $113,315.64; and NOW, THEREFORE, IT BE RESOLVED, by the City Council of the City of Hugo, Minnesota, as follows: 1. The portion of the cost of the roadway improvement is hereby declared to be $113,315.64; and the portion of the cost to be assessed against benefited property owners is declared to be $113,315.64. 2. Assessments shall be payable in equal annual installments extending over a period of 10 years, the first of the installments to be payable on or before the first Monday in January 2023 and shall bear interest at the rate of 4.25 percent per annum from the date of the adoption of the assessment resolution. 3. The city clerk, with the assistance of the city engineer, shall forthwith calculate the proper amount to be specially assessed for such improvement against every assessable lot, piece or parcel of land within the district affected, without regard to cash valuation, as provided by law, and he shall file a copy of such proposed assessment in his office for public inspection. 4. The clerk shall upon the completion of such proposed assessment, notify the council thereof.
